From the award-winning author of Weasels in the Attic, a modern
fable about the world of work Beyond the town, there is the
factory. Beyond the factory, there is nothing. Within the sprawling
industrial complex, three new employees are each assigned a
department. There, each must focuses on a specific task: one shreds
paper, one proofreads documents, and another studies the moss
growing all over the expansive grounds. As they grow accustomed to
the routine and co-workers, their lives become governed by their
work--days take on a strange logic and momentum, and little by
little, the margins of reality seem to be dissolving: Where does
the factory end and the rest of the world begin? What's going on
with the strange animals here? And after a while--it could be weeks
or years--the three workers struggle to answer the most basic
question: What am I doing here? With hints of Kafka and Beckett and
unexpected moments of creeping humour, The Factory is a vivid, and
sometimes surreal, portrait of the absurdity and meaninglessness of
the modern workplace.
